2015-11-29 2 views
0

Возможно ли создать новый пакет SSIS с помощью только T-SQL?Можете ли вы создать пакеты SSIS с T-SQL?

Специфичность Я использую SQL Server 2016, я еще не много сделал с SSIS.

+0

Ответ отрицательный. – BobF

+0

Этот учебник (https://msdn.microsoft.com/en-us/library/ms169917(v=sql.130).aspx) проведет вас по этапам создания вашего первого пакета служб SSIS. Эта серия статей (http://www.sqlservercentral.com/stairway/72494/) покажет вам еще много методов. – BobF

+0

Зависит от того, что вы имеете в виду. Возможно, это возможно, но здравомыслящий человек не захотел бы этого сделать. –

ответ

0

Вы не можете. Некоторые элементы в пакете SSIS не могут быть выражены TSQL. Вы можете создавать пакеты программно с использованием C# или VB (https://msdn.microsoft.com/en-us/library/ms345167.aspx), но не TSQL. Однако после его создания вы можете использовать пакет самостоятельно или добавить его как часть одного из нескольких шагов задания агента SQL с помощью TSQL (creating job with ssis step using tsql).

+0

Если мы упоминаем инструменты, которые могут генерировать пакеты SSIS динамически, [BIML] (https://en.wikipedia.org/wiki/Business_Intelligence_Markup_Language), по-видимому, используются крутыми детьми. –